mirror of
https://github.com/pfloos/quack
synced 2025-05-07 07:35:02 +02:00
undid sign change
This commit is contained in:
parent
da65737cc0
commit
a8d89aa933
@ -65,7 +65,7 @@ subroutine cRGF2_QP_graph(eta,nBas,nC,nO,nV,nR,eHF,e_cap,ERI,Re_eGFlin,Im_eGFlin
|
||||
Re_f = Re_w - eHF(p) - Re_SigC
|
||||
Im_f = Im_w - e_cap(p) - Im_SigC
|
||||
Re_df = (1d0 - Re_dSigC)/((1d0 - Re_dSigC)**2 + Im_dSigC**2)
|
||||
Im_df = -Im_dSigC/((1d0 - Re_dSigC)**2 + Im_dSigC**2)
|
||||
Im_df = Im_dSigC/((1d0 - Re_dSigC)**2 + Im_dSigC**2)
|
||||
|
||||
Re_w = Re_w - Re_df*Re_f + Im_df*Im_f
|
||||
Im_w = Im_w - Re_f*Im_df - Re_df*Im_f
|
||||
|
@ -82,6 +82,6 @@ subroutine cRGF2_self_energy_diag(eta,nBas,nC,nO,nV,nR,e,ERI,Re_SigC,Im_SigC,Re_
|
||||
end do
|
||||
end do
|
||||
Re_Z(:) = (1d0-Re_DS(:))/((1d0 - Re_DS(:))**2 + Im_DS(:)**2)
|
||||
Im_Z(:) = -Im_DS(:)/((1d0 - Re_DS(:))**2 + Im_DS(:)**2)
|
||||
Im_Z(:) = Im_DS(:)/((1d0 - Re_DS(:))**2 + Im_DS(:)**2)
|
||||
deallocate(Re_DS,Im_DS)
|
||||
end subroutine
|
||||
|
@ -76,7 +76,7 @@ subroutine cRGW_QP_graph(doSRG,eta,flow,nBas,nC,nO,nV,nR,nS,eHF,e_cap,Om,rho,Re_
|
||||
Re_f = Re_w - eHF(p) - Re_SigC
|
||||
Im_f = Im_w - e_cap(p) - Im_SigC
|
||||
Re_df = (1d0 - Re_dSigC)/((1d0 - Re_dSigC)**2 + Im_dSigC**2)
|
||||
Im_df = -Im_dSigC/((1d0 - Re_dSigC)**2 + Im_dSigC**2)
|
||||
Im_df = Im_dSigC/((1d0 - Re_dSigC)**2 + Im_dSigC**2)
|
||||
Re_w = Re_w - Re_df*Re_f + Im_df*Im_f
|
||||
Im_w = Im_w - Re_f*Im_df - Re_df*Im_f
|
||||
|
||||
|
@ -97,6 +97,6 @@ subroutine cRGW_self_energy_diag(eta,nBas,nOrb,nC,nO,nV,nR,nS,e,Om,rho,EcGM,Re_S
|
||||
|
||||
! Compute renormalization factor from derivative
|
||||
Re_Z(:) = (1d0-Re_DS(:))/((1d0 - Re_DS(:))**2 + Im_DS(:)**2)
|
||||
Im_Z(:) = -Im_DS(:)/((1d0 - Re_DS(:))**2 + Im_DS(:)**2)
|
||||
Im_Z(:) = Im_DS(:)/((1d0 - Re_DS(:))**2 + Im_DS(:)**2)
|
||||
deallocate(Re_DS,Im_DS)
|
||||
end subroutine
|
||||
|
Loading…
x
Reference in New Issue
Block a user